The grounds for a personal injury lawsuit, according to the Virginia Model Jury Instructions, are as follows:
- The accused party must have owed you a duty of care
- The accused must have made a mistake or did something that breached that duty of care
- Breach duty must be the direct or indirect cause of your damages or resulting injuries
- You must have suffered injuries or losses that affected your life
As can be seen, there is no requirement that you suffer injuries that are life-threatening or fatal to pursue a lawsuit. Insurance Settlements
In most personal injury claims, liable parties have insurance coverage. For instance, if you are involved in a car crash, the driver that hit you should be insured according to Virginia auto insurance requirements under Virginia Law §46.2-472. You would file a claim with the liable party’s auto insurance provider since Virginia follows fault insurance laws under Virginia Law §38.2-117.
However, no matter what type of accident you were involved in, you should never rely on an insurance settlement alone. Not only are insurance companies often unwilling to settle claims fairly, but these settlements do not cover every loss. Typically, insurance settlements only pay for specific types of covered losses and leave you stuck with any damages that exceed the policy’s coverage limits.
Personal Injury Lawsuits
When insurance is not enough, you are not without further options. You may have the right to file a personal injury lawsuit in civil court. While Virginia does not cap the amount of compensation that can be awarded for compensatory damages, there are several caps you should be aware of.
If you are dealing with a medical malpractice lawsuit, the total amount of compensation you can be awarded is $2.6 million according to Virginia Code §8.01-581.15. There is also a cap on the maximum amount of punitive damages that can be awarded. According to Va. Code Ann. §8.01-38.1, no more than $350,000 can be awarded in exemplary damages.
